General Synthesis and Gas‐Sensing Properties of Multiple‐Shell Metal Oxide Hollow Microspheres
Institute of Process Engineering · The University of Texas at Austin
Abstract
A sphere of many coats: A facile sequential templating process for the general preparation of metal oxide hollow microspheres with multiple shells (red), such as α-Fe2O3, Co3O4, NiO, CuO, ZnO, and ZnFe2O4, may open up new opportunities for preparing advanced materials based on complex hollow structures with multipurpose applications.
